obsidian_genius at yahoo.com (Jill Obsidian) writes: > I have need to write some Python scripts that run on Windows as well > as Linux/Unix. > > In some instances I will be making os.system() calls to execute > applications installed locally on the machine. > > How can I put a check in my script which will allow me to determine > whether I'm running on Windows or Linux at execution time? If you want to run an executable, don't check for the system - check whether the executable exists: os.path.exists("/bin/ps"). HTH, Martin
